Output afa7b5d4853fc64a8ba324df0d470de39ec4c1a61db1344a6048ea91811945e8:0

value
22751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c80473e39df0a4986693c06b1f9a162558a457 OP_EQUAL
address
3MBPTrb2mBoaxmpdeXVF9qnV1CbmvNHVsG
transaction
afa7b5d4853fc64a8ba324df0d470de39ec4c1a61db1344a6048ea91811945e8
confirmations
217989
spent
true